Abstract
Compositions, methods of using inorganic moieties for dielectric modulation, and related device structures.

A dielectric composition comprising a multi-layered composition, the multi-layered composition comprising periodically alternating layers, the alternating layers comprising (a) one or more layers comprising a silyl or siloxane moiety, (b) one or more layers comprising a π-polarizable moiety, and (c) one or more layers comprising an inorganic moiety comprising one or more main group metals and/or transition metals selected from Zr, Ti, Hf, and Ta.
2 . The dielectric composition of claim 1 , wherein at least some of the alternating layers are coupled to an adjacent layer by a coupling layer comprising a siloxane matrix.
3 . The dielectric composition of claim 1 , wherein the silyl moiety has the formula selected from —Si(CH 2 ) n Si—, —Si(CHF) n Si—, and —Si(CF 2 ) n Si—, wherein n is 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9 or 10.
4 . The dielectric composition of claim 1 , wherein the π-polarizable moiety comprises a stilbazolium group.
5 . The dielectric composition of claim 1 comprising self-assembled monolayers comprising a silyl moiety.
6 . The dielectric composition of claim 1 comprising self-assembled monolayers comprising a π-polarizable moiety.
7 . The dielectric composition of claim 2 , wherein at least some of the alternating layers are coupled to one another or the siloxane matrix via a condensation reaction.
8 . The dielectric composition of claim 2 , wherein at least some of the alternating layers are coupled to one another or the siloxane matrix via chemisorption.
